NRG Stadium: Houston’s Premier Venue
NRG Stadium is more than just a building; it’s a landmark etched into the landscape of Houston’s sporting history. Built in 2002, this multi-purpose stadium quickly became a focal point for major events, solidifying its position as a premier venue in the United States. It is home to the Houston Texans of the National Football League (NFL) and has played host to countless concerts, conventions, and other large-scale gatherings.
The stadium boasts an impressive capacity of over 72,000 seats, offering a diverse range of viewing options for fans. NRG Stadium’s resume is filled with significant events, showcasing its versatility and ability to host world-class competitions. It has been the proud host of two Super Bowls, showcasing the NFL’s championship game to a global audience. Additionally, it has welcomed legendary musicians for sold-out concerts, transforming the stadium into a vibrant music venue. When it comes to soccer, the stadium has previously hosted friendlies and CONCACAF Gold Cup matches, providing experience in hosting international football.
